CUSIP No. 70614W100 — 1. NAMES OF REPORTING PERSONS John Paul Foley
2. CHECK THE APPROPRIATE BOX IF A MEMBER OF A GROUP (a) ☐ (b) ☐
3. SEC USE ONLY
4. CITIZENSHIP OR PLACE OF ORGANIZATION United States
NUMBER OF SHARES BENEFICIALLY OWNED BY EACH REPORTING PERSON WITH 5. SOLE VOTING POWER 19,524,577(1)(2)
6. SHARED VOTING POWER 155,264(2)(3)
7. SOLE DISPOSITIVE POWER 19,524,577 (1)(2)
8. SHARED DISPOSITIVE POWER 155,264(2)(3)
9. AGGREGATE AMOUNT BENEFICIALLY OWNED BY EACH REPORTING PERSON 19,679,841(1)(2)(3)
10. CHECK BOX IF THE AGGREGATE AMOUNT IN ROW (9) EXCLUDES CERTAIN SHARES ☐
11. PERCENT OF CLASS REPRESENTED BY AMOUNT IN ROW (9) 6.96%(4)
12. TYPE OF REPORTING PERSON IN

(1) Represents (i) 400,000 shares of Class A common stock, (ii) 5,766,232 shares of Class B common stock and (iii) 13,358,345 shares underlying options to purchase Class A common stock and Class B common stock that are exercisable within 60 days of December 31, 2020, of which 1,985,417 shares are unvested and subject to repurchase by the Issuer.

(2) Each share of Class B common stock is convertible at any time at the election of the holder into one share of Class A common stock.

(3) Represents 155,264 shares underlying options to purchase Class A common stock and Class B common stock held by Jill Foley that are exercisable within 60 days of December 31, 2020, of which 64,792 shares are unvested and subject to repurchase by the Issuer, which shares the Reporting Person could be deemed to have voting or dispositive power over.

(4) The percentage reported in row 11 is calculated in accordance with Rule 13d-3 based on the aggregate number of shares of Class A common stock and Class B common stock beneficially owned by the Reporting Person assuming conversion of the Class B common stock into Class A common stock (and excluding the conversion of shares of Class B common stock held by other persons) and an aggregate of 263,494,223 shares of Class A common stock outstanding as of December 31, 2020, as reported by the Issuer to the Reporting Person, plus the number of options to purchase shares of Class A common stock and Class B common stock held by the Reporting Person that are exercisable within 60 days of December 31, 2020, which are treated as converted into Class A common stock only for the purpose of computing the percentage ownership of the Reporting Person .
